About Lagotto Romagnolo
Medium-sized Italian water and truffle dog with a sturdy build and dense, curly, low-shedding coat needing regular grooming. Affectionate, sensitive, and people oriented, it is highly trainable and thrives on scent work, mental challenges, and active outdoor family life.
About Great Pyrenees
Large, calm livestock guardian from the Pyrenees, the Great Pyrenees is a powerful white, heavy‑shedding dog with a thick coat and double dewclaws. Gentle yet strongly protective, it needs secure fencing, steady socialization, mental stimulation, and experienced, patient handling.
